Always watching

Scraler notices before you do.

A client goes quiet. A workout gets skipped. Meal-plan adherence starts to slip. Each one is a trigger Scraler watches for on its own — no reports to pull, no roster to comb through.

Twelve triggers to build on

From a client going inactive to a subscription about to expire — each one can start an automation.

Catches the quiet ones

Inactivity, missed workouts, and missed appointments surface before a client drifts away.

Good news counts too

Workouts completed, days active, streaks, and weight milestones fire triggers — not just problems.

Instant reactions

Detected at 7:00 — handled by 7:01.

When a trigger fires, the response goes out immediately: a chat message, a check-in request, a new plan. You write it once; Scraler sends it every time.

Messages that sound like you

Write the message once with placeholders like {first_name} — every client gets a personal version.

Check-ins on cue

Request a check-in the moment adherence slips, and the client gets it in their app.

Plans and payments too

Assign a training or meal plan, send a payment request, or generate a progress summary automatically.

Milestones celebrated automatically

Workouts completed, days active, streaks, and weight goals get a message without you watching the counters.

Expiring subscriptions flagged

An automation fires before a subscription runs out — while there is still time to act.

Conditions and delays

Add if/else branches and timed waits when a straight trigger-to-action is not enough.

Onboarding on rails

New client at midnight — welcomed by 12:01.

The moment a subscription activates, your onboarding automation runs: a welcome message lands in their chat and their starting plan is already assigned — whether you were awake for it or not.

Welcome message, instantly

The greeting goes out the moment their subscription activates.

Starting plan included

Their first training or meal plan is assigned in the same run, so day one is never empty.
